Formal menswear brand Charles Tyrwhitt is set to open a new shop in Trafford Centre in November. 

The new 1,776 sq ft shop will be located on Upper Regent Crescent and will stock all the brand’s latest Autumn Winter 2024 collections. 

The collection features both formalwear and casualwear, including shirts, suits, knitwear, polos, shoes, and accessories. 

Visitors to the store will also have the opportunity to receive one-on-one styling appointments. 

As part of the brand’s ongoing commitment to climate positive projects, the store will feature the shirt and suit recycling scheme, rewarding customers who bring in old shirts and suits with discounts. 

The Trafford Centre store joins the retailer’s portfolio of 36 stores in the UK as well as being the tenth store to open in a two-year period.
